In 1866 J lister suggested antiseptic surgery. His rational was (????????) :
* Putrefaction is caused by microbes
* Wound sepsis is a form of putrefaction
* Wound sepsis is caused by microbes
* In the previous year Lister had heard that ‘carbolic acid’ was being used to treat sewage in Carlise, and that fields treated with the affluent were freed of a parasite causing disease in cattle.
* Lister then began to clean wounds and dress them using a solution of carbolic acid. He was able to announce at a British Medical Association meeting, in 1867, that his wards at the Glasgow Royal Infirmary had remained clear of sepsis for nine months.
* Opposition was great In England and the United States mainly against Lister’s germ theory rather than against his “carbolic treatment.”
